近年来,随着人工智能技术的快速发展,RAG(Retrieval-Augmented Generation)技术逐渐成为数据处理和分析领域的重要工具。RAG技术结合了检索和生成两种技术,能够有效地提升数据处理的效率和准确性。本文将深入探讨RAG技术的核心实现方法及其优化策略,为企业用户在数据中台、数字孪生和数字可视化等领域的应用提供参考。
RAG技术是一种结合了检索和生成的混合技术,旨在通过检索相关数据来增强生成模型的输出效果。其核心思想是利用检索模块从大规模数据中快速找到与查询相关的上下文信息,并将其提供给生成模块,从而生成更准确、更相关的回答。
RAG技术在数据中台、数字孪生和数字可视化等领域具有广泛的应用场景。例如,在数据中台中,RAG技术可以帮助企业快速检索和分析海量数据,生成实时的业务洞察;在数字孪生中,RAG技术可以辅助生成更精准的数字模型;在数字可视化中,RAG技术可以提升数据展示的交互性和智能化水平。
RAG技术的核心实现主要包括检索模块、生成模块和融合模块三个部分。以下是各模块的具体实现方法:
检索模块是RAG技术的基础,其主要功能是从大规模数据中快速找到与查询相关的上下文信息。为了实现高效的检索,检索模块通常采用以下技术:
生成模块是RAG技术的核心,其主要功能是根据检索到的上下文信息生成高质量的回答。生成模块通常采用以下技术:
融合模块是RAG技术的关键,其主要功能是将检索模块和生成模块的结果进行融合,生成最终的输出结果。融合模块通常采用以下方法:
为了进一步提升RAG技术的性能和效果,可以从以下几个方面进行优化:
数据质量是RAG技术性能的基础,高质量的数据能够显著提升检索和生成的效果。以下是数据质量优化的具体方法:
模型优化是提升RAG技术性能的重要手段,主要包括以下方面:
计算效率是RAG技术大规模应用的关键,以下是提升计算效率的具体方法:
RAG技术在数据中台、数字孪生和数字可视化等领域具有广泛的应用场景。以下是具体的应用案例:
在数据中台中,RAG技术可以帮助企业快速检索和分析海量数据,生成实时的业务洞察。例如,企业可以通过RAG技术快速找到与某个业务指标相关的数据,并生成相应的分析报告。
在数字孪生中,RAG技术可以辅助生成更精准的数字模型。例如,企业可以通过RAG技术快速检索和分析物理世界中的数据,并生成对应的数字孪生模型。
在数字可视化中,RAG技术可以提升数据展示的交互性和智能化水平。例如,企业可以通过RAG技术快速生成与用户查询相关的数据可视化图表,并提供相关的分析建议。
随着人工智能技术的不断发展,RAG技术在未来将朝着以下几个方向发展:
未来的RAG技术将更加注重多模态数据的融合,支持文本、图像、音频等多种数据类型的检索和生成。
未来的RAG技术将更加注重实时性,能够快速响应用户的查询,并生成实时的业务洞察。
未来的RAG技术将更加注重自适应能力,能够根据实时数据和用户反馈,动态调整检索和生成策略,提升系统的适应性。
RAG技术作为一种结合了检索和生成的混合技术,已经在数据中台、数字孪生和数字可视化等领域展现了广泛的应用前景。通过优化数据质量、模型性能和计算效率,RAG技术可以进一步提升其在实际应用中的效果。未来,随着人工智能技术的不断发展,RAG技术将在更多领域发挥重要作用。
如果您对RAG技术感兴趣,欢迎申请试用我们的相关产品:申请试用。
申请试用&下载资料